What Personal Data Does Rufus Casino Collect?
| Data Category | Examples of Data | Purpose of Collection | Retention Period |
| Account Data | Name, Email, Date of birth | Identify you, verify age, enable login | Until account closure + 2 years |
| Financial Data | Deposit history, withdrawal methods | Process payments, meet anti‑money‑laundering rules | 7 years (regulatory requirement) |
| Technical Data | IP address, device ID, browser type | Prevent fraud, optimise performance | 30 days (anonymous after) |
| Gaming Behavior | Betting patterns, session duration, game preferences | Personalise offers, detect problem gambling | 2 years after last activity |
Sensitive Data and Enhanced Due Diligence (KYC)
When you submit identification for verification, the compliance team stores passport scans, driver’s licence photos, and proof of address in a separate encrypted repository. Only senior AML officers can access these files, and they review each document within 48 hours.
Data from Third-Party Payment Processors and Aggregators
Payment gateways such as Skrill, PayPal, and Worldpay forward transaction IDs, currency codes, and risk scores to Rufus Casino. The casino records the gateway’s reference number alongside your internal deposit ID, creating a full audit trail for every monetary movement.

Your Rights Under GDPR and CCPA: Access, Rectification, and Erasure
Step-by-Step Guide to Submitting a Data Subject Access Request (DSAR)
Log into your account, navigate to the privacy hub, select “Request My Data,” and confirm the request with two‑factor authentication; the compliance team then emails a downloadable PDF within 30 days.
How to Opt-Out of Data Sales (CCPA) and Targeted Advertising
Visit the CCPA preferences page, toggle the “Do not sell my personal information” switch, and click Save; the system records your choice in the master consent ledger.
Data Portability: Exporting Your Gaming History and Transaction Logs
You can request a CSV file that lists every bet, win, and deposit from the past five years, and the platform emails the file securely to your registered address.

Security Measures: How Rufus Casino Safeguards Your Data
Encryption Protocols and Secure Socket Layer (SSL) Certificates
The IT department deploys TLS 1.3 for all web traffic and rotates SSL certificates quarterly, preventing eavesdropping on any data exchange.
Internal Access Controls and Employee Training
Role‑based permissions restrict data access to the minimum needed, and the compliance team conducts quarterly privacy workshops for all staff.
Breach Notification Procedures and Incident Response
If a breach occurs, the security operations centre triggers a predefined playbook, notifies affected players within 72 hours, and reports the incident to the ICO and relevant regulators.
Data Storage Locations and Cross-Border Transfers (EU vs. US)
Primary servers reside in a UK data centre that complies with ISO 27001, while backup replicas sit in an EU‑approved cloud region; any transfer to the US passes through Standard Contractual Clauses.
